Analysis

In 2018, germany — fibreboard — import quantity in Malaysia stood at 146 m3.

That represents a change of down 44.5% on the previous year and down 75.0% over ten years.

Over the whole period, germany — fibreboard — import quantity in Malaysia peaked at 2,679 m3 in 2006 and was at its lowest, 20 m3, in 1998.

That places Malaysia 87th out of 126 countries with data for 2018, putting it in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
